How Elle Woods' Origin Story in Elle Differs From Legally Blonde
Key Points:
- The new Prime Video series "Elle," premiering July 1, serves as a prequel to the 2001 film "Legally Blonde," exploring Elle Woods' high school years with Lexi Minetree portraying the younger Elle.
- The show shifts Elle's early life from sunny Los Angeles to rainy Seattle, highlighting her challenges fitting into a grunge-dominated high school, while maintaining the character's optimism and kindness.
- Elle's parents are given expanded roles, with Tom Everett Scott and June Diane Raphael playing Dr. Wyatt Woods and Eva Woods, respectively, adding depth to Elle's background.
- The iconic chihuahua Bruiser appears in the series, portrayed by multiple dogs and a stuffed animal stand-in, maintaining continuity with the original films.
- "Elle" has been renewed for a second season, indicating strong confidence in the show's potential to expand on Elle Woods' story beyond the original movie.
